Kogi: APC prepared for any scenario, says Odigie-Oyegun; Buhari, Osinbajo, Saraki, govs to attend Bello’s inauguration

The All Progressives Congress (APC) says the party is prepared for the January 27 inauguration of Alhaji Yahaya Bello as governor of Kogi State.
National Chairman of the party, Chief John Odigie-Oyegun, said this on Monday in Abuja.
“All I can say is that the party is fully prepared for any conceivable scenario on the issue of a deputy governor in Kogi State,’’ Odigie-Oyegun said.
The APC flag bearer for the governorship position, Prince Abubakar Audu, died on the day the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) declared the election results inconclusive.
Following the development, Audu’s deputy, Mr James Faleke, declared himself as governor-elect and subsequently rejected a joint ticket with the party’s choice of Bello.
Meanwhile, President Muhammadu Buhari and his deputy, Prof. Yemi Osinbajo, are among the dignitaries expected at the January 27 inauguration of Alhaji Yahaya Bello in Lokoja, the state capital.
This is contained in a statement on Monday in Lokoja by Alhaji Ishak Ajibola, the Chairman, Media and Publicity Committee set up for the inauguration ceremony.
The statement said that the Senate President, Dr. Bukola Saraki, governors, ministers and chieftains of APC were invited to the event.
According to the statement, the event would hold at the Confluence Stadium, Lokoja and feature cultural display among other side attractions.
It stated that law enforcement agents have been directed to take strategic positions in and around the venue to ensure a hitch- free event.
“Motorists moving in and out of Lokoja are advised to comply with speed limit on the roads and obey traffic rules to avoid unnecessary traffic.
“The people are enjoined to be orderly, peaceful and cooperate with law enforcement agents,’’ the statement said.
